Fa-Jun Nan is a scholar working on Oncology, Molecular Biology and Organic Chemistry. According to data from OpenAlex, Fa-Jun Nan has authored 18 papers receiving a total of 455 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Oncology, 12 papers in Molecular Biology and 8 papers in Organic Chemistry. Recurrent topics in Fa-Jun Nan’s work include Peptidase Inhibition and Analysis (13 papers), Carbohydrate Chemistry and Synthesis (6 papers) and Neuropeptides and Animal Physiology (6 papers). Fa-Jun Nan is often cited by papers focused on Peptidase Inhibition and Analysis (13 papers), Carbohydrate Chemistry and Synthesis (6 papers) and Neuropeptides and Animal Physiology (6 papers). Fa-Jun Nan collaborates with scholars based in China and United States. Fa-Jun Nan's co-authors include Jing-Ya Li, Qi-Zhuang Ye, Ling‐Ling Chen, Jia Li, Qun‐Li Luo, Qingqing Huang, Min Gu, Xing-Zu Zhu, Yahui Zhang and Yihua Chen and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Biochemistry.
